There will be plenty of smiles across the red half of Manchester on Monday after what transpired at Anfield this weekend.

Manchester United not only beat the reigning Premier League champions on their home patch for the first time since 2016, they were also good value for their win. Ruben Amorim's side started brilliantly, scoring inside the opening two minutes and setting the tone for one of their best performances under Amorim.

After Cody Gakpo's equaliser with 12 minutes to go, it felt like momentum was with the hosts but Harry Maguire's late header ensured that the three points would be returning to Manchester.
